The age of Melinda is 51. Melinda's birth date was listed as 1973. The phone number (636) 625-3436 is Melinda’s. Cities Melinda has lived in before are O Fallon and Lake St Louis. Melinda’s current address is 560 Cherry St, Troy, Mo 63379.